OCTOBER 4TH. - NEWHAVEN, SUSSEX.
A naval patrol boat had been reported overdue and the life-boat searched for her during the night. She found nothing, but the patrol boat returned next day. - Rewards, £18 9S....

THE summer of this year has not been as busy a time for the life-boats as the record summer of 1948, but during June, July and August life-boats were launched 169 times and rescued 92 lives.
